Jose Mourinho has revealed that he is not planning to make wholesale changes to the team for the meaningless match against Sporting Lisbon in the Champions League. Chelsea will top Group G irrespective of the result at Stamford Bridge on Wednesday night.
This was seen as an opportunity for Mourinho to completely change the team. The Portuguese boss has largely fielded the same line-up since last international break. He has only brought in players like Didier Drogba and Mikel due to suspensions. Only Terry, Willian, and Hazard will not be involved against Sporting. Speaking ahead of the match, Mourinho said:
“Terry, Willian and Hazard are on holidays. I would like to give the whole squad the time off but we are always playing and we have good solutions for those positions, so they are off and they will not play.
“We have so many matches to play in December, we are one of the few teams in the Premier League that also play in the Capital One Cup.
“Of the other teams involved in the Champions League, only Liverpool are involved in the Capital One Cup, so they all have periods to rest, we don’t. This game gives me the chance to rest those players.”
Chelsea have won only once in the last three matches and the issue of tiredness has been mentioned as a possible reason.
